Sunday Suspense involves a dramatised reading of Bengali classics, usually from the horror and crime genre. There have been close to 500 such episodes since the show went on air in 2009.

Shankar Roy Chowdhury (), the protagonist, is a 20-year-old man, recently completed his First Arts graduation and about to take up a job in a mill, a prospect he absolutely loathes. He yearns for adventure, wild lands, forests and animals. He wants to follow the footsteps of famous explorers like,,, all of whom he has read about and idolizes.

One evening Shankar is chased by a man-eating lion and luckily he reaches his cabin and locks the door. The next day he asks the head stationmaster to provide him with a Springfield bolt-action rifle and carbolic acid as a day before he encounters another hazard in Africa: the poisonous.

He miffs the black mamba with his torchlight. The next day he gets these things from another fellow Indian, Tirumal Appa, who is serving the British Army. They quickly strike a rapport and Tirumal visits him often. One day Tirumal becomes victim of the same man-eating lion. This rages Shankar and he decides to end this peril. He poses as bait by pouring blood on himself and scatters meat chunks. He tempts the lion out of his cave and eventually shots him down.

He rescues and looks after the middle-age Portuguese explorer and, Diego Alvarez. The encounter with Alavarez influences him deeply. Alavarez tells him of his exploits and adventures, how he and his companion Jim Carter had braved deep jungles and mountains of to find the largest. However, they were thwarted by the legendary, a mythical monster who guards the mines and killed Carter. Shankar gives up his job and accompanies Alvarez as he decides to venture out once more and find the mines again.

They meet with innumerable hardships. The first is a raging which forces them to halt their expedition. One night they were attacked by the monster Bunyip. Eventually they get lost in the forests where Alvarez is killed by the monster, in an effort to save Shankar's life. Desolated Shankar mourns the death of Alvarez deeply.
